What is AI Lead
Qualification and How It Works?

AI lead qualification is the process of using artificial intelligence to evaluate and prioritize potential customers based on their likelihood to convert into paying clients. This technology streamlines the sales funnel by automating lead scoring and assessment, allowing businesses to focus on high-potential leads.

Key Components of AI Lead Qualification

Several key components underpin the AI lead qualification process:

  • Data Collection: AI tools gather data from various sources, including CRM systems, website interactions, and social media activity. This data forms the basis for understanding lead behavior and preferences.
  • Natural Language Processing (NLP): NLP enables AI to interpret and analyze user interactions, particularly in chatbots and customer support, facilitating more personalized engagement.
  • Predictive Analytics: By analyzing historical data, AI can predict future behavior, assessing the likelihood of leads converting based on past interactions.

Improved Conversion Rates

AI lead qualification helps prioritize leads based on their likelihood to convert, thereby increasing conversion rates. Through lead scoring, AI evaluates leads using various criteria, such as:

  • Engagement Levels: Frequency of interactions with your content.
  • Demographic Information: Age, location, and other relevant data.
  • Behavioral Data: Actions taken on your site or in previous campaigns.

For example, when a lead fills out a contact form, the AI tool analyzes their previous interactions with your site and scores them accordingly. If they have engaged with your content multiple times, they may be prioritized for follow-up, increasing the chances of conversion.

Assessing Your Current Lead Qualification Process

Before integrating AI into your lead qualification efforts, evaluate your existing process. Identify the criteria you currently use to assess leads, such as demographic information, engagement levels, and behaviors. Consider the following steps:

  1. Map Your Process: Document each stage of your lead qualification process from initial contact to conversion. This helps in understanding where AI can add value.
  2. Identify Pain Points: Look for areas where your current process is slow or ineffective. For instance, if manual lead scoring takes too much time, that’s a potential opportunity for automation.
  3. Gather Data: Ensure you have quality data on your leads. AI relies heavily on historical data to make predictions. If your data is outdated or incomplete, it can skew results.

Selecting the Right AI Tools for Integration

Once you have a clear understanding of your current process, the next step is to choose the right AI tools. Here are some factors to consider:

  1. Compatibility: Ensure the AI tool can seamlessly integrate with your existing CRM, such as HubSpot or Klaviyo. For example, HubSpot AI features like predictive lead scoring can be directly incorporated into your workflows.
  2. Functionality: Look for tools that offer specific capabilities relevant to your needs. If you require natural language processing for chatbots, ensure the AI tool supports it.
  3. Automation Ability: Choose tools that can automate repetitive tasks. For instance, when a lead fills out a form on your website, the AI can score the lead and trigger follow-up actions automatically.
  4. Customization: AI lead qualification tools should allow for customization of scoring models to fit your business context. Generic models may not yield accurate predictions.
  5. Data Privacy: With increasing regulations, select tools that prioritize data privacy and compliance.

Customizing Lead Scoring Models

Understanding how AI lead qualification works involves recognizing that a one-size-fits-all approach to lead scoring simply doesn’t exist. Each business has unique characteristics and customer profiles that influence what makes a lead valuable.

  • Define Criteria: Start by identifying the key attributes of your ideal customer. This could include demographic information, engagement history, and specific actions (like website visits or email opens).
  • Use Historical Data: Leverage existing data to inform your scoring system. Look at past conversions to determine which behaviors correlate with successful leads.
  • Adjust Regularly: AI models are not static. Continuously refine your scoring criteria based on new data and market changes. For example, if you notice that leads from a specific industry are converting at higher rates, adjust your model to prioritize these leads.

Ensuring Data Quality and Compliance

Effective AI lead qualification relies heavily on the quality of your data. Poor data can lead to inaccurate lead scoring, wasting time and resources.

  • Data Cleaning: Regularly audit your data for accuracy. Remove duplicates and correct any inconsistencies. For instance, if a lead’s email address appears in multiple formats, standardize it to ensure consistency.
  • Compliance Considerations: Be mindful of data privacy regulations like GDPR and CCPA. Ensure that your lead qualification processes comply with these laws. This might involve obtaining explicit consent from leads before collecting their data or providing options for them to opt out of data collection.
  • Integrate Tools: Use platforms like HubSpot or Klaviyo that have built-in compliance features. These tools can help manage consent and ensure that your data practices align with legal requirements.

Misconceptions About AI Capabilities

One common misconception about AI is that it can fully replace human judgment in lead qualification. While AI can analyze data and provide insights, it should be viewed as a supportive tool rather than a replacement for human decision-making. For example, AI can identify patterns in data, but it cannot understand the nuances of human interaction or the context behind a lead's behavior.

Another misconception is that a one-size-fits-all lead scoring model is effective for every business. In reality, the scoring model should be tailored to the specific needs of each organization. Factors like industry, target audience, and customer behavior can significantly affect how leads should be scored.

Additionally, many expect immediate results after implementing AI tools. However, effective AI lead qualification requires time for data training and model refinement. Initial outcomes may not reflect the long-term benefits of a well-tuned AI system.

Managing Data Quality Risks

Data quality is a significant concern when implementing AI lead qualification. Poor data quality can lead to inaccurate predictions and ineffective lead scoring. Businesses should ensure that their data is clean, consistent, and up-to-date before integrating AI tools.

For instance, if a lead fills out a form but provides incorrect information, this can skew the AI’s assessment of that lead's potential. Regular data audits and validation processes are essential to maintain the integrity of the lead qualification process.

Moreover, when using platforms like HubSpot or integrating with tools such as Klaviyo or Zapier, it’s crucial to establish clear data governance practices. This includes setting protocols for data collection, storage, and usage to minimize risks associated with data quality.

Scenario: A SaaS Company’s Lead Management

Imagine a SaaS company that provides project management software. The company uses HubSpot to manage its leads. When a potential customer fills out a form on their website, this action triggers an automation in HubSpot, marking the lead as "new."

Once classified as new, the AI lead qualification system begins its process. It analyzes the lead's information, such as job title, company size, and engagement with previous content. Based on these criteria, the system assigns a lead score. The higher the score, the more likely the lead is to convert into a paying customer.

Automation Triggers and Workflows

After scoring, the lead enters a workflow designed to nurture it further. For instance:

  1. Email Follow-Up: The lead receives an automated email welcoming them and providing resources related to their specific interests. This email is tailored based on previous interactions, enhancing the relevance of the content.
  2. Behavior Tracking: The system continues to monitor the lead’s interactions, such as website visits and email opens. If a lead shows significant engagement, like visiting the pricing page multiple times, the AI updates the lead score accordingly.
  3. Sales Notification: When the lead reaches a predefined score threshold, the sales team is notified. This could trigger a personal outreach from a sales representative, increasing the chances of conversion.

This AI-driven approach allows the SaaS company to prioritize leads effectively without overwhelming their sales team. By automating initial communications and tracking engagement, the company can focus its resources on leads that are most likely to convert.
